Establishing Clear Communication Protocols
Establishing clear communication protocols in boutique law firms involves creating structured guidelines that define how, when, and through which channels clients and the firm interact. This clarity ensures consistent messaging and reduces misunderstandings, fostering a professional environment grounded in transparency and reliability.
A well-defined protocol includes setting expectations for response times, preferred communication methods (such as email, phone calls, or secure messaging), and the types of information shared at various stages of legal proceedings. Clear protocols streamline processes, making client interactions more efficient and predictable.
Additionally, documenting these protocols and sharing them with clients upfront helps manage expectations. It ensures clients understand the communication process, their responsibilities, and the boundaries of engagement, which is particularly vital in boutique firms where personalized service is prioritized. Implementing such protocols enhances client confidence and strengthens trust in the firm’s commitment to effective communication.

Digital Tools Enhancing Client Engagement
Digital tools play a vital role in enhancing client engagement within boutique law firms by streamlining communication processes. Secure client portals enable easy document sharing, real-time updates, and direct messaging, fostering transparency and convenience. These platforms help build trust through consistent and accessible communication channels.
Video conferencing tools, such as Zoom or Microsoft Teams, facilitate personal interactions beyond traditional office visits. They allow for more flexible scheduling and enable lawyers to address client concerns promptly, strengthening the client-lawyer relationship in a personalized manner.
Legal practice management software also enhances communication by centralizing client data, appointment scheduling, and case updates. These systems improve efficiency and ensure clients stay informed about their case status, reducing misunderstandings or miscommunications.
While digital tools significantly benefit client engagement, it is essential for boutique law firms to prioritize data security and compliance. Proper implementation ensures that sensitive information remains confidential, reinforcing client trust and professional integrity.

Communication Skills Workshops
Communication skills workshops are structured training sessions designed to enhance the interpersonal and professional communication abilities of law firm staff. These workshops focus on equipping participants with practical tools to improve client interactions, foster trust, and handle sensitive issues effectively.
In such workshops, participants are often engaged in activities that develop key skills such as active listening, clear articulation of legal information, and empathetic dialogue. This targeted training aligns with the importance of client communication in boutique law firms, where personalized service and trust are paramount.
Typically, these workshops include:
- Role-playing scenarios simulating client interactions
- Techniques for managing difficult conversations
- Strategies for delivering clear, jargon-free explanations of complex legal matters
- Methods to recognize and respond to client emotional cues
Implementing these workshops within boutique law firms encourages consistent, effective communication and ensures staff can meet high client service standards, ultimately strengthening client relationships.

Measuring the Effectiveness of Client Communication
Evaluating how well client communication functions in boutique law firms involves multiple methods. These assessments help identify strengths and areas for improvement, ensuring clients remain satisfied and engaged. Reliable measurement tools include feedback mechanisms and performance metrics.
Client feedback and satisfaction surveys are among the most effective strategies. Soliciting direct input from clients provides insights into their perceptions of communication clarity, responsiveness, and overall experience. Regular surveys can highlight consistent issues or positive trends.
Benchmarking communication performance can be achieved through key indicators. These include response times, resolution rates, and the frequency of proactive updates. Tracking these metrics over time helps firms adapt their communication strategies and enhance service quality.
Finally, implementing continuous improvement strategies ensures ongoing enhancement of client communication. Review of feedback and performance data should lead to actionable changes, fostering transparency and trust. Employing these methods helps boutique law firms align communication practices with client expectations.
